Output d0e88d36936ba213d9d564e81d36d2072baf20e8f798cc07ab0a66de7648bc15:0

value
66794
script pubkey
OP_0 OP_PUSHBYTES_20 2dc1c9f7da43cc0205a2f2c94bd337799ac0a0c9
address
bc1q9hquna76g0xqypdz7ty5h5eh0xdvpgxfjp6d5g
transaction
d0e88d36936ba213d9d564e81d36d2072baf20e8f798cc07ab0a66de7648bc15
confirmations
73660
spent
true